Le Petit Olivier

It was in 1996 that co-founders Xavier Padovani and Eric Renard were to create La Phocéenne de Cosmétique based on a simple idea: to make high-quality cosmetic products that draw their beneficial effects directly from nature and respect old traditions, available to everyone by commercialising them in large-scale distribution.

The Le Petit Olivier brand which was dreamt up in 1999 was not launched until 2003. While Provence and its scents were sources of inspiration, the strong values of Le Petit Olivier quickly integrated into the brand in a world which very much became its own.

Its name was not down to mere chance. The olive tree, a symbol of universal values, represents ancient culture for its ability to adapt which enables it to offer a richness which defies arid soil. The olive tree, a one thousand year old tree, grows in poor soil requiring a lot of sunshine and care.
A symbol of strength and wisdom in Ancient Greece, its prestige has never ceased to grow on a scale with its expansion.
From Greece to Spain, including Egypt, Italy, Tunisia, Morocco and France, the olive tree firmly established itself in the areas surrounding the Mediterranean up until the 19th century. With the period of major exploration it even crossed the Straits of Gibraltar to travel towards more "exotic" lands such as California, Mexico, Chilli, South Africa and Australia...

That is the spirit of Le Petit Olivier: to draw the original beneficial effects of nature directly from the natural, sensorial and cultural wealth of the regions.
